IC71 Solar Photovoltaics I
| Course Number | IC71 |
| Course Title | Solar Photovoltaics I |
| Course Description | Develop a working knowledge of basic concepts of Photovoltaics (PV) systems and their components, along with general sizing and electrical/mechanical design requirements. Practice conducting a site survey, identifying a suitable location, and interpreting radiation and temperature data for installing a PV array. Engage in system design and configurations for PV installation. Gain the knowledge, skills, and industry credentials for careers in architecture and construction. * For safety reasons, the recommended enrollment should not exceed 20 students. |
